Subspace was seen holding a crystal to his eye, examining it. He observed how light would be filtered through it, beaming through its pink, faceted surfaces and feeling how brittle it was in his fingers.

“Ahoy!” A voice called out from behind him.

Subspace jumped, snarling at the voice that seemingly just appeared from right behind him.
“What is it??” He snapped, turning to face whoever greeted him.

Skateboard was hovering right behind him, peering at the bright pink crystal that Subspace had in his hand.
“So, what’s the deal with that crystal?” He asked, leaning a bit closer. “That thing was pretty much the whole reason we got robbed.”

Subspace grumbled.
“It’s nothing YOU should be concerned about! It’s none of your business!” Subspace scowled, moving the crystal farther from Skateboard and pushing him away.

“But it is kinda our business! We saw you use that thing, what’s the big deal?” Skateboard urged, leaning even closer.

“I said it’s nothing you should be concerned about!” Subspace insisted.

“But if those True Eyes or whoever want it, isn’t it at least super valuable?” Skateboard asked, looking at Subspace.

Subspace stiffened. He glared at Skateboard, wide-eyed before sighing loudly.
“Fine!” He relented, his eye narrowing at Skateboard. “Since you want to know so badly! But you better not tell anyone about this, alright? Not outside of the crew!”

“Aye, captain.” Skateboard agreed. Subspace presented the crystal to Skateboard again.

“This crystal has some pretty powerful properties. It’s not much in its raw form, but once shaped and refined, it can take on the properties of the wielder and give them some extra power.” Subspace explains, twirling the crystal in his hand.
“Done right, it can be very powerful. I’ve made great discoveries with these, created things most can’t even imagine making.”

“Ooh. Sweet!” Skateboard began to reach for the crystal.

“Don’t touch it!” Subspace hissed, taking it away from Skateboard.

“I just wanna take a better look!” Skateboard protested.

“I’m on a finite supply! Without these, we have no form of defense!” Subspace checks on the crystal again. “You can’t touch these, anyways! You don’t want to break them!”
Subspace pulled the sleeve on his right arm.

Skateboard sighed, putting his hands in his pockets.
“Alright, whatever. Can’t you just get more?”

Subspace tsked.
“Must I answer every question?” Subspace then shakes his head.
“I can’t get them. A mer took them all from me. That’s half the reason why I’m out here, to go look for him!”

Skateboard’s eyes widened.
“Seriously?”

Subspace cursed under his breath.
“Once we find the artifact, I’m not sailing straight home. We’re going to go look for them.”

Skateboard stopped.
“Wait, but–”

“I never told you how long we’d be out at sea for. If you find a white whale mer with a teal crystal between his horns, alert me immediately. He’s our biggest priority. I’ll pay extra if you do.” Subspace glanced out at sea.

Skateboard stood silent for a minute.
“...Aye, captain.”

"I'm not answering any more questions! Now go!" He barked, making a shooing gesture.

"Alright, Alright! I'm leaving! Geez!" Skateboard huffed, taking a few steps back before walking off somewhere else on the ship.
